#18c540 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18c540 is composed of 9.4% red, 77.3%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.5%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 133.9 degrees, a saturation of 78.3% and a lightness of 43.3%. #18c540 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ff80 with #008b00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#18c540 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#18c540 has RGB values of R:24, G:197,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.68,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 1623360.

Shades and Tints of #18c540
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010502 is the darkest color, while #f2fd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#18c540
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d706e is the less saturated color, while #07d637 is the most saturated one.
